As an Engineer I struggle to reconcile the reality that so much is built atop OpenSource Software, so much is learned from free and open knowledge banks... and rarely is much paid back in developer time, contributions, or funding.
Here I'm trying to hand pick a few OSS initiatives, and free, Creative Commons licensed knowledge sharing services that I believe still attempt to maintain the original intent of the Internet.
Way I figure it, supporting OSS and Creative Commons is good mojo toward the career of any engineer who uses these tools, and for me it's a moral issue. Yes, not as critical as humanitarian aid, but in the long-haul, likely pretty effective towards the Internet & Tech that I dream of.
